What's the itinerary?+
• The journey starts at the picturesque fishing village of Taqah, located along Oman's southern coastline. This historic settlement is famous for its traditional Dhofari architecture and the local delicacy of dried sardines. • Taqah Castle, a historic fort in Taqah, Oman, was constructed in the 19th century and served as the residence for the local governor, symbolizing regional authority. The castle showcases intricate architecture, featuring traditional Omani designs. Visitors can explore its rooms, learn about its past, and enjoy stunning views of the surrounding landscape. • Taqah Viewpoint offers a stunning view of the town of Taqah, set against rugged mountains and the Arabian Sea. It is an ideal location for capturing memorable photographs and appreciating the serene beauty of the area. • Wadi Darbat is a hidden treasure located in the heart of Dhofar, boasting lush scenery, seasonal waterfalls, and clear pools. Guests can take a leisurely walk along its paths amidst towering cliffs and vibrant plant life. For a more adventurous option, there is a trek from one end of the valley to the other, revealing hidden corners and waterfalls. Relax at the wadi's tranquil spring, where activities such as pedal boating, kayaking, or motor boating (at an extra cost) are available, all while enjoying views of the Jabal Qara mountain range. A visit to Salalah is not complete without experiencing this natural sanctuary, making Wadi Darbat a popular site in the Dhofar region. • Tawi Ateer Sinkhole is a notable natural phenomenon in Dhofar, Oman. Descending into the sinkhole involves a challenging trek requiring good physical fitness, but the striking beauty of the sinkhole and the sense of achievement make the effort worthwhile. Other natural wonders in Dhofar, such as Teeq Cave, also offer memorable experiences. • This location, often referred to as the ‘Grand Canyon’ of Dhofar, provides a panoramic view of the east coast on one side and the expansive ‘Qara’ mountain range on the other, as well as a breathtaking plateau at nearly 1700m high in the Jebel Samhan range. • Wadi Hannah is characterized by its distinctive baobab trees, known for their large trunks and unusual forms, which are indigenous to Africa and Madagascar. The presence of these trees enhances the enchanting atmosphere of the wadi. • One of Dhofar's intriguing attractions is the so-called "Anti-Gravity Hill," an optical illusion also known as Magnetic Hill, which creates the effect that vehicles appear to roll uphill even when in neutral gear.
